Interview with Ms. Arlene K. Talaue, ASC (FIN)


By Our Own Correspondent


Manila, the Philippines, 29 March 2019 -- What makes you happy as a Salesian Cooperator?


Being a Salesian Cooperator has bought me so much happiness because is has deepened my understanding and love for the young, especially the poor and the marginalized, through the great example and inspiration of St John Bosco, while working and growing with my fellow Salesians, with an attitude of joy and optimism.


How do you prepare yourself as a formator? What do you need for your task?


First of all, I acknowledge that I’m just an instrument of God in His mission, thus in everything I pray that God through His Holy Spirit will be the one to move me and inspire in any task that I do as a formator.


As a formator, I need to constantly form myself through openness to new learnings and constant appreciation of my vocation as a Salesian Cooperator. Secondly, I need to commit my time, talent, skills and resources for the formation program.


What exchange among the EAO Salesian Cooperators do you dream about?


I’m looking forward to hearing the vocation stories of my fellow Salesian Cooperators and also experiences on the fruits of a good formation such as personal transformation and meaningful apostolate works.


What do you expect from the 2019 EAO Formators Workshop in Cambodia?


I’m expecting that I will be transformed and be more inspired as an individual with relevant input to have impact not only at the level of the head, but more importantly at the level of the heart and soul. I’m also expecting to build a deeper connection with my fellow formators through sharing our common goals and vision as well as our challenges and difficulties as a formator.
